// This actually calls the service to perform the tax calculation, and returns the calculation result. public GetTaxResult GetTax(GetTaxRequest req) { var jsonRequest = JsonConvert.SerializeObject(req); // Call the service var address = new Uri(svcURL + "tax/get"); var request = WebRequest.Create(address) as HttpWebRequest; request.Headers.Add(HttpRequestHeader.Authorization, "Basic " + Convert.ToBase64String(ASCIIEncoding.ASCII.GetBytes(accountNum + ":" + license))); request.Method = "POST"; request.ContentType = "text/json"; request.ContentLength = jsonRequest.Length; var newStream = request.GetRequestStream(); newStream.Write(ASCIIEncoding.ASCII.GetBytes(jsonRequest), 0, jsonRequest.Length); var result = new GetTaxResult(); try { using (var response = (HttpWebResponse)request.GetResponse()) { // Get the stream containing content returned by the server. newStream = response.GetResponseStream(); // Open the stream using a StreamReader for easy access. using (var reader = new StreamReader(newStream)) { result = JsonConvert.DeserializeObject <GetTaxResult>(reader.ReadToEnd()); } } } catch (WebException ex) { if (ex.Response == null) { result.ResultCode = SeverityLevel.Error; result.Messages = new[] { new Message { Severity = SeverityLevel.Error, Summary = ex.Message } }; return(result); } using (var response = ex.Response) { using (var data = response.GetResponseStream()) { // Open the stream using a StreamReader for easy access. using (var reader = new StreamReader(data)) { result = JsonConvert.DeserializeObject <GetTaxResult>(reader.ReadToEnd()); } } } } return(result); }

public static void Test() { // Header Level Elements // Required Header Level Elements string accountNumber = ConfigurationManager.AppSettings["AvaTax:AccountNumber"]; string licenseKey = ConfigurationManager.AppSettings["AvaTax:LicenseKey"]; string serviceURL = ConfigurationManager.AppSettings["AvaTax:ServiceUrl"]; TaxSvc taxSvc = new TaxSvc(accountNumber, licenseKey, serviceURL); GetTaxRequest getTaxRequest = new GetTaxRequest(); // Document Level Elements // Required Request Parameters getTaxRequest.CustomerCode = "ABC4335"; getTaxRequest.DocDate = "2014-01-01"; // Best Practice Request Parameters getTaxRequest.CompanyCode = "APITrialCompany"; getTaxRequest.Client = "AvaTaxSample"; getTaxRequest.DocCode = "INV001"; getTaxRequest.DetailLevel = DetailLevel.Tax; getTaxRequest.Commit = false; getTaxRequest.DocType = DocType.SalesInvoice; // Situational Request Parameters // getTaxRequest.CustomerUsageType = "G"; // getTaxRequest.ExemptionNo = "12345"; // getTaxRequest.BusinessIdentificationNo = "234243"; // getTaxRequest.Discount = 50; // getTaxRequest.TaxOverride = new TaxOverrideDef(); // getTaxRequest.TaxOverride.TaxOverrideType = "TaxDate"; // getTaxRequest.TaxOverride.Reason = "Adjustment for return"; // getTaxRequest.TaxOverride.TaxDate = "2013-07-01"; // getTaxRequest.TaxOverride.TaxAmount = "0"; // Optional Request Parameters getTaxRequest.PurchaseOrderNo = "PO123456"; getTaxRequest.ReferenceCode = "ref123456"; getTaxRequest.PosLaneCode = "09"; getTaxRequest.CurrencyCode = "USD"; // Address Data Address address1 = new Address(); address1.AddressCode = "01"; address1.Line1 = "45 Fremont Street"; address1.City = "San Francisco"; address1.Region = "CA"; Address address2 = new Address(); address2.AddressCode = "02"; address2.Line1 = "118 N Clark St"; address2.Line2 = "Suite 100"; address2.Line3 = "ATTN Accounts Payable"; address2.City = "Chicago"; address2.Region = "IL"; address2.Country = "US"; address2.PostalCode = "60602"; Address address3 = new Address(); address3.AddressCode = "03"; address3.Latitude = (decimal)47.627935; address3.Longitude = (decimal) - 122.51702; Address[] addresses = { address1, address2, address3 }; getTaxRequest.Addresses = addresses; // Line Data // Required Parameters Line line1 = new Line(); line1.LineNo = "01"; line1.ItemCode = "N543"; line1.Qty = 1; line1.Amount = 10; line1.OriginCode = "01"; line1.DestinationCode = "02"; // Best Practice Request Parameters line1.Description = "Red Size 7 Widget"; line1.TaxCode = "NT"; // Situational Request Parameters // line1.CustomerUsageType = "L"; // line1.Discounted = true; // line1.TaxIncluded = true; // line1.BusinessIdentificationNo = "234243"; // line1.TaxOverride = new TaxOverrideDef(); // line1.TaxOverride.TaxOverrideType = "TaxDate"; // line1.TaxOverride.Reason = "Adjustment for return"; // line1.TaxOverride.TaxDate = "2013-07-01"; // line1.TaxOverride.TaxAmount = "0"; // Optional Request Parameters line1.Ref1 = "ref123"; line1.Ref2 = "ref456"; Line line2 = new Line(); line2.LineNo = "02"; line2.ItemCode = "T345"; line2.Qty = 3; line2.Amount = 150; line2.OriginCode = "01"; line2.DestinationCode = "03"; line2.Description = "Size 10 Green Running Shoe"; line2.TaxCode = "PC030147"; Line line3 = new Line(); line3.LineNo = "02-FR"; line3.ItemCode = "FREIGHT"; line3.Qty = 1; line3.Amount = 15; line3.OriginCode = "01"; line3.DestinationCode = "03"; line3.Description = "Shipping Charge"; line3.TaxCode = "FR"; Line[] lines = { line1, line2, line3 }; getTaxRequest.Lines = lines; GetTaxResult getTaxResult = taxSvc.GetTax(getTaxRequest); // Print results Console.WriteLine("GetTaxTest Result: " + getTaxResult.ResultCode.ToString()); if (!getTaxResult.ResultCode.Equals(SeverityLevel.Success)) { foreach (Message message in getTaxResult.Messages) { Console.WriteLine(message.Summary); } } else { Console.WriteLine("Document Code: " + getTaxResult.DocCode + " Total Tax: " + getTaxResult.TotalTax); foreach (TaxLine taxLine in getTaxResult.TaxLines ?? Enumerable.Empty <TaxLine>()) { Console.WriteLine(" " + "Line Number: " + taxLine.LineNo + " Line Tax: " + taxLine.Tax.ToString()); foreach (TaxDetail taxDetail in taxLine.TaxDetails ?? Enumerable.Empty <TaxDetail>()) { Console.WriteLine(" " + "Jurisdiction: " + taxDetail.JurisName + "Tax: " + taxDetail.Tax.ToString()); } } } }
